Full title and description

IEC 61280-4-1:2019/COR2:2022 — Corrigendum 2 to "Fibre-optic communication subsystem test procedures — Part 4-1: Installed cabling plant — Multimode attenuation measurement". This corrigendum is a one-page correction to the third edition (2019) that consolidates and corrects editorial and technical items in the published standard.

Abstract

This corrigendum (Corrigendum 2, 2022) issues small but important corrections to IEC 61280-4-1:2019 (Edition 3.0). It clarifies application details and corrects text and figures where needed to ensure consistent interpretation of the multimode attenuation measurement procedures (including launch conditions and reference-cord handling) for installed cabling plant. The corrigendum is published in English and French and is provided as a consolidated one‑page correction to the 2019 edition.

Scope

Applies to measurement of attenuation of installed multimode optical‑fibre cabling plants (connectors, adapters, splices and passive devices) using multimode fibres (A1/OM categories). The main document (IEC 61280-4-1:2019) defines measurement methods, launch conditions (encircled flux), equipment-cord and reference‑cord handling, and guidance on OTDR and insertion‑loss techniques; this corrigendum corrects and clarifies specific text and figures in that context.

Related standards

Related publications and reference documents include other parts of the IEC 61280 series (test procedures for optical communication subsystems), IEC 61280-4-2 (single‑mode attenuation and optical return loss measurements for installed cable plant), IEC 60793 (fibre category definitions), IEC TR 62614 series (encircled flux guidance), and IEC 61300 series (fiber optic test and measurement procedures).
